SYSTRA Canada is part of the SYSTRA group, an international consulting and engineering group, a world leader in the design of transport infrastructures. SYSTRA Canada is an engineering and consulting firm whose primary focus is to offer transportation solutions, whether for passengers or goods: feasibility studies of building a new railway line, increasing the capacity of the existing infrastructure, privatization of a railway.

Context

The Rolling Stock Engineer will act as a lead for rolling stock projects and proposals, ensuring high-quality outcomes and profitability. 

Missions/Main Duties

Project Management

  • Leads or participates in rolling stock projects, including studies, procurement, and maintenance facility design.
  • Develops solutions and technical documentation, and manages the full procurement process from specifications to commissioning.
  • Oversees project initiation, scheduling, budgeting, team coordination, and client communication.
  • Prepares technical and financial proposals in collaboration with internal and marketing teams.

Relationships & Expertise

  • Collaborates with multidisciplinary teams, clients, and suppliers to deliver successful projects.
  • Maintains client satisfaction and seeks new business opportunities.
  • Serves as a rolling stock expert and ensures the delivery of high-quality project documentation.
Profile/Skills

Education: Bachelor's degree in mechanical, electrical, or industrial engineering required. Member of OIQ is required. 

Years of Experience: Minimum 10–15 years' experience in the design, manufacturing, or maintenance of North American diesel or electric rolling stock. Experience in functional design of maintenance facilities and specifying maintenance equipment. Experience with light rail vehicles, track maintenance equipment, and overseas consulting is an asset.

Technical Skills:

  • Expertise in rolling stock systems, maintenance facility design, and equipment specification.
  • Proficiency in preparing technical documentation and proposals.
  • Clear verbal and written communication skills, both in French and in English*

*Reasons for requiring bilingualism: You will have the opportunity to work with a varied clientele, including both French- and English-speaking companies. Bilingualism is therefore fundamental to building strong relationships with our customers, understanding their specific needs and communicating effectively in their preferred language.

Soft Skills:

  • Strong teamwork and leadership abilities.
  • Ability to work independently, often under tight deadlines.
  • Excellent communication and technical writing skills.

Travel requirements: Willingness to travel domestically and internationally for short-term assignments.
